About the role:

We are looking for experienced care assistants to work for a leading care provider in the local area, assisting adults with various complex needs. This will be done within a care home setting, working as a team member around Leeds and Harrogate, as well as the surrounding areas. Duties will include:

  • Creating a home environment that exceeds the needs of the adults, enabling them to develop their characters, feel safe, and enrich their lives.
  • Providing a stimulating environment, implementing educational, personal, and social development of the adults.
  • Contributing to the residents' care plans and risk assessments.
  • Supporting residents with personal care and manual handling.
  • Meeting the emotional and physical needs of our residents and maximizing opportunities for their development.
  • Promoting independence and supporting residents with daily tasks.
